The image is of a PowerPoint slide featuring the GE/McKinsey Matrix, a strategic tool used for prioritizing investments among business units. The matrix is a grid with two axes: "Industry Attractiveness" on the vertical axis and "Business Unit Strength" on the horizontal axis. It is divided into nine cells, each varying in color from green (attractive) to red (unattractive), representing different levels of priority from "Invest/Grow" to "Divest/Harvest". The slide indicates strategic directions for business units based on their position in the matrix.
